THE CHALLENGE
Build one display platform around a changing product category.
That makes a fixed display increasingly difficult to manage.
The fixture needed to provide a strong branded presentation while giving ASSA ABLOY the flexibility to update the program as products, graphics and store requirements changed.
Smart locks are an evolving category. Product assortments change, different brands may need to share a merchandising platform, and individual retail locations can require different configurations.
Adapt to different assortments
Support different combinations of smart locks without redesigning the entire fixture.
Work across store footprints
Allow the display footprint to expand or contract depending on the location.
Support multiple brands
Create a common fixture architecture capable of presenting different ASSA ABLOY brands and products.
Simplify future updates
Make product and graphic changes easier to execute in the field.
THE SOLUTION
A retail display designed as a system, not a single fixture.
Benchmarc developed a modular display architecture based around repeatable one-foot sections.
Each module could be configured with interchangeable product mounts and removable graphics, giving ASSA ABLOY a common platform that could evolve along with the merchandising program.

One-foot modular sections
Repeatable one-foot-wide modules allow the fixture footprint to be configured around the assortment and available retail space.
Replaceable graphics
Removable back graphics make brand, product and campaign updates easier to execute.
Interchangeable product mounts
Swappable mounts allow different lock products to be incorporated without rebuilding the entire merchandising system.
Built-to-order configurations
Displays can be assembled according to the requirements of an individual order rather than forcing every location into the same configuration.

THE SHOPPER EXPERIENCE

Make smart-lock technology easier to discover and evaluate.
Smart locks combine physical hardware with technology, security and connected-home functionality.
At retail, shoppers need to quickly understand what they are looking at and distinguish between available products.
A structured fixture helps give each lock a defined merchandising position while maintaining a consistent presentation across the assortment.
